LINCOLN PARK COMMITTEE MINUTES <br />October 2, 2013 meeting at 4 pm at the bathrooms <br />Members present — David Williams, Chair, Brian Kelley, Lynne Wilson, Bob Pressman and Cindy Kuechle <br />Also present— Wendy Rudner, Recreation, Wesley Wirth, Landscape Architect, Miles Connors, Parterre <br />Bathroom update — Brian Kelley told the group that NSTAR had been at the site the day before, the <br />electrician had been there that day but the wiring was not completed but close. The committee toured <br />the site and expressed approval. <br />Bathroom landscaping — Wes Wirth talked about the drainage, recommending deep stone strips that <br />would drain to a grassy swale. He also recommended paving the entire perimeter with porous <br />pavement. The cost to do the drainage and recommended landscaping is approximately $15,000. <br />Bob Pressman told the group that he had walked the path and that the azaleas needed water badly. <br />He was concerned about their condition. Part of the group walked the mound area and agreed. Both <br />Bob and David said they would try to get water on them in the next couple of days. Miles said that <br />Parterre would be on site the next Tuesday and would water also. Wes asked that, since it was so dry, <br />Parterre should, perhaps, spend some of the time allocated to weeding to watering. <br />The meeting was adjourned at 5:30pm. <br />Respectfully submitted, <br />c <br />Lynne ison <br />
